 I can't get this card to work in MD 7.0. According to the 
"howto's" this
 card is supposed to be supported. Using Lothar the card 
is identified as
 Ensoniq ES1371.  All of the settings use -1 and don't 
offer any other
 settings.  Testing the card in Lothar locks up the 
computer. Trying to use

 other cards settings just says that the device or 
resource is busy. During

 boot I can see where it loads the sound module. What do I 
need to do? Any
 help appreciated.

I had a similar problem with a NIC. Here is what I did. I queried to see if
the module was installed: modprobe xx.x (I think emu10k1) and even
though it was trying to load it upon boot  lothar recognized it, it was not
installed. I next did insmod x.x. This installed the module. I rebooted
and viola all was well.
